Woodstonians Tee Off in Sister City for Friendly Tournament

For 20 years golfers from Woodstock and Sylvania Ohio have met up for a golf tournament to bring the cities closer together.

A friendly golf match is uniting some Woodstonians with golfers from the sister city of Sylvania, Ohio. 

16 golfers representing the Friendly City will travel to Ohio to play their 20th annual match. As it stands right now, the team from Ohio is out in front, having won 10 of the last 19 meetings.

Rick Young, founder of the event, says it isn't about the score, it's about the relationships they build.

"There is a lot of comradery, a lot of friendships - a lot of incredible friendships that have been over the past 20 years since we started it. It is probably the thing I am most proud of with the event."

Each year the cities alternate turns hosting the event. Young says the game is important, but it goes beyond that.

"Not a huge deal, it is just the idea of going down there to celebrate the game, to celebrate both golf courses, and to celebrate match play, because that is what it is, a match play event."

He says the two cities are home to wonderful golf courses.

"It has been good, they have a tremendous golf course down there. We think we have a great one here at Craigowan, which we do. Craigowan is a tremendous golf course, in terms of playability and fun. They have a very similar golf course down there and they actually host a LPGA tour event, the Marathon classic, at Highland Meadows in Sylvania."

This could be the last year for the long standing tournament, so there is plenty of pride on the line as the Canucks look to go out on a tie.
